Man, I am so frustrated this morning. I just found out I got blacklisted at my favorite record store! I'm officially on their 'Do Not Buy From' list.
And I want to add, for the record, I'm completely innocent. Rasputin's, out here in the Bay Area ... you've turned on me.

But here's what sucks: I've spent so much time and money at this store it's crazy. I don't shop at Best Buy for music or movies ... I gladly spend the extra money to buy it there, to support the local record store. I spend HOURS flipping through their used CDS. When my friends come into town, we make special roadtrips to their Berkeley and San Francisco stores. I drive all the way down to their San Leandro store just to flip through their used stuff. When I make trips into their larger Berkeley and San Francisco stores I get lists emailed to me by my friends, so I buy stuff from them for people in other states. And they're blacklisting me?!? Evidently, I've been on the list since August. Which is odd, since I've sold stuff since then.

They say you can get on the list for selling large numbers of sealed CDs. NEVER sold a sealed CD. Or you can get on this list for selling multiple copies of the same CD. NEVER done that (why buy more than one?). And here was the kicker ... the manager said I could've been on the list because some of the stuff I was selling might have been in too good of condition. So I could be getting blacklisted for taking care of my CDs?

Of course, the guy I have to talk to in order to clear my name is off on Wednesday's.

But I feeling suckerpunched. Betrayed. Like a girl just broke up with me. I go out of my way to support this store -- and am ALWAYS honest -- and I get blacklisted.

I just talked to their head buyer this morning (he's been off) and he says he can't see any reason why I'm on the list. I went in with the attitude that it was just a misunderstanding and we cleared it up.
He said he would call the other stores and get me off the list (as long as the manager at my local store said there was no issues ... and he shouldn't because I already talked to him).

It was a gut-punch to be blacklisted at my favorite record store, but it was very reassuring to know that they care about honest customers and can admit their mistake.
